Avocado is a species of plant in the laurel family. Botanically, it is considered a berry. The cultivation of avocados in tropical areas of the world, such as South and Central America, Southeast Asia and Africa, began more than 10,000 years ago. Today they also grow in subtropical areas, such as in southern Spain or in Israel. Hardly any other food is as versatile as the avocado. The energy content corresponds to 4 apples or 2 bananas. Thus, they provide the brain cells with a lot of energy, which in turn reduces stress. Due to the high content of vitamin B6 and folic acid, they are also considered to improve fertility. The vitamins A, B and E contained also stimulate the formation of new cells and slow down the aging process.
Use:
Probably the best-known recipe is guacamole, which finds lovers in the morning, at noon and in the evening. It can also be found in many other spreads, sushi, pasta, tacos and many other dishes.
Storage:
It is best to store ripe avocados in the vegetable compartment of the refrigerator at around 6 degrees Celsius, as they continue to ripen at room temperature. To prevent brown discoloration on cut surfaces, this can be prevented with a little lemon juice. The core also helps the avocado stay fresh longer.
